These photos don't tell much. One has to see them in person, or get better quality photos. Espresso is darker. Note that there is NO expresso color for Cayenne seats - it's only for the dash. Cognac is a color that is very suitable for Lexus type of vehicles IMO.

Personally I'm fine with umber - this is probably similar to the tobacco color in X5 - but a two tone look would be better.
